Furyk & Friends program to benefit area youth

Posted

The Constellation FURYK & FRIENDS presented by Circle K is preparing to return for a second year to Timuquana Country Club on Oct. 3-9. The 2022 PGA TOUR Champions event will once again include the Community Champions program, which gives MaliVai Washington Youth Foundation supporters the opportunity to designate 100% of the proceeds from their general admission ticket purchase to the nonprofit.

“We’ve had a longstanding friendship and partnership with Jim and Tab and the Constellation Furyk & Friends Foundation,” said MaliVai Washington Youth Foundation founder MaliVai Washington. “Their support has been immeasurable, providing additional resources for our families and supporting our STEM program, among other things.”

In 2021, the Constellation FURYK & FRIENDS presented by Circle K generated more than $1.17 million for local charities and with support of this program, the tournament will look to grow that number in the future.

The tournament will feature a 78-player field competing for a $2 million purse. The no-cut event will include pro-ams on Oct. 3, 5 and 6, followed by three rounds of tournament play October 7-9.

All three rounds of the tournament will be broadcast live on Golf Channel, the exclusive cable provider of PGA TOUR Champions.

The MaliVai Washington Youth Foundation is a comprehensive youth development program in Jacksonville’s urban core that provides youth with valuable opportunities to rise to their potential through academic assistance, life skills, enrichment activities, counseling, mentoring, college and career preparation, tennis lessons and more.

The Jim & Tabitha Furyk Foundation was created in 2010 to help children and families in need. This Jacksonville based nonprofit partners with charities across North Florida to provide project-specific funding and essential programing.

The annual Constellation FURYK & FRIENDS presented by Circle K was created to raise charity dollars to support these partnerships and brings the community together to increase awareness and funding for programs that support education, health care, nutrition and safety for at-risk children and families.

Programs created from the support of the Jim & Tabitha Furyk Foundation in the Jacksonville Community include: Hope for the Holidays, which packs more than 5,000 bags filled with a holiday meal for at-risk families; Operation Shower, which provides car seats, strollers and baby essentials to active military families; Blessings in a Backpack, which feeds thousands of food-insecure children each week of the school year; and Childcare specialists and services to provide medically complex children’s care through Wolfson’s and Community PedsCare.
